The industry of streamer content creators is growing more and more. However, the leadership of twitch wobbles every month.
With the continuous complaints from important streamers such as the Spanish, AuronPlay, IbaiLlanos and ElRubius, added to the arrival on the market of the ‘Kick’ platform, the company, an Amazon subsidiary, decided to create a new program that motivates new streamers.
This is ‘Partner Plus’, a program where the earnings of the income of the streamer per subscriber at 70%.
The new Twitch Partner Program, which will take effect from October 2023, pays streamers a 70% share of net subscription revenue to those who meet the qualification criteria (with Twitch keeping the other 30%). ). The standard revenue split that Twitch offers streaming partners is 50%. To qualify, Twitch partners must maintain a secondary count of at least 350 recurring paid subscriptions for three consecutive months, a US media report reveals.

Through a statement on its social networks, the company reported the new program that would eliminate the current ’50/50′ where users must share half of their profits with the platform.
‘Partner Plus’ conditions
It is important to note that this new option will only be available for a period of 12 months.
“To meet the criteria and be eligible to participate, partners must have at least 350 paid recurring subscriptions for three months in a row. When that happens, members will automatically enter the program for the next 12 months, and they will continue in it, even if their subscriptions fall below the minimum throughout that period, ”says the release of the company.
The Partner Plus program will go live on October 1, 2023. If streamers meet the participation requirements in July, August and September, they will be added to the program in October and will receive a notification.
